/**
 * Computes the total fees for an operation group (all ops sharing the same hash).
 *
 * In Tezos, `bakerFee` is charged only on the top-level op, but `storageFee` and
 * `allocationFee` can appear on internal ops emitted by contracts as well.
 */
function computeFees(group: APITransactionType[]): bigint {
  return group.reduce((sum, op) => sum + computeOpFees(op), 0n)
}

/**
 * Determines who paid the fees for an operation group.
 *
 * The fee payer is the top-level op's `initiator` (when a contract triggered the
 * call) or its `sender` (for direct user operations).  The "top-level" op is the
 * one that carries a non-zero `bakerFee`; if none exists we fall back to the first
 * op in the group.
 */
function findFeesPayer(group: APITransactionType[]): string | undefined {
  const topLevelOp = group.find((op) => (op.bakerFee ?? 0) > 0) ?? group[0]
  return topLevelOp?.initiator?.address ?? topLevelOp?.sender?.address
}

/**
 * Returns `true` only when every op in the group succeeded.
 *
 * Tezos can partially execute a batch (later ops get "backtracked"), so we treat
 * the whole group as failed if any op did not reach "applied" status.  Fees are
 * still charged in that case, but no balance changes took effect.
 */
function isGroupSucceeded(group: APITransactionType[]): boolean {
  return group.every((op) => !op.status || op.status === 'applied')
}

/**
 * Produces one outgoing and one incoming `BlockOperation` for each transaction in the group
 * that should be represented in the block.
 *
 * Transactions are skipped only when both the transferred amount and the fees are zero.
 * Fee-only transactions (amount === 0 but fees > 0) are kept so fee attribution and
 * sender/target linkage match `listOperations`.
 *
 * Fees are intentionally excluded from amounts — they are reported separately in
 * `BlockTransaction.fees`.  In Tezos, the `amount` field on `APITransactionType`
 * already represents only the transferred value, so no adjustment is required
 * (unlike XRPL, where the raw balance diff includes the fee deduction).
 */
function buildNativeOperations(group: APITransactionType[]): BlockOperation[] {
  const ops: BlockOperation[] = []
  for (const tx of group) {
    const amount = BigInt(tx.amount ?? 0)
    if (amount === 0n && computeOpFees(tx) === 0n) continue

    const fromAddr = tx.sender?.address
    const toAddr = tx.target?.address

    if (fromAddr) {
      ops.push({
        type: 'transfer',
        address: fromAddr,
        ...(toAddr && { peer: toAddr }),
        asset: NATIVE_ASSET,
        amount: -amount,
      })
    }
    if (toAddr) {
      ops.push({
        type: 'transfer',
        address: toAddr,
        ...(fromAddr && { peer: fromAddr }),
        asset: NATIVE_ASSET,
        amount,
      })
    }
  }
  return ops
}

/**
 * Produces outgoing / incoming `BlockOperation` entries for a single FA transfer.
 *
 * Minting events (`from` absent) produce only the incoming entry; burning events
 * (`to` absent) produce only the outgoing entry.
 */
function buildTokenOperations(transfer: APITokenTransfer): BlockOperation[] {
  const tokenAmount = BigInt(transfer.amount)
  if (tokenAmount === 0n) return []

  // For FA2, multiple token IDs coexist under one contract address.
  // Encoding both as "address:tokenId" makes every token uniquely identifiable.
  // FA1.2 tokens always have tokenId "0", so this format is safe for both standards.
  const tokenId = transfer.token.tokenId ?? '0'
  const asset: AssetInfo = {
    type: transfer.token.standard,
    assetReference: `${transfer.token.contract.address}:${tokenId}`,
    name: transfer.token.metadata?.name ?? transfer.token.metadata?.symbol,
  }

  const fromAddr = transfer.from?.address
  const toAddr = transfer.to?.address
  const ops: BlockOperation[] = []

  if (fromAddr) {
    ops.push({
      type: 'transfer',
      address: fromAddr,
      ...(toAddr && { peer: toAddr }),
      asset,
      amount: -tokenAmount,
    })
  }
  if (toAddr) {
    ops.push({
      type: 'transfer',
      address: toAddr,
      ...(fromAddr && { peer: fromAddr }),
      asset,
      amount: tokenAmount,
    })
  }
  return ops
}
